Last night, I traveled to Oshkosh, WI with my co-pilot and friend of the show, Melanie Cholka, Beauties of America Wisconsin’s 40’s Melanie Cholka to see the Miss Wisconsin 2009 pageant.

To see our photos from before the event, check out our photo gallery.

The pageant itself was wonderful with at least 4 production numbers based upon the theme of “Xanadu.”  This was a very strong year for competition. We were wowwed (Is wowwed a word? Now it is.) with each portion of the competition. The ladies were beautiful in each phase of competition. Particularly strong this year was the Swimsuit competition which was one of the buzzes of the pageant. Every single one of the ladies were dynamite in this very challenging and competitive portion of the competition.

The musical breaks from Briana Lipor, Miss Wisconsin 2008, and a fabulous trio of trumpets rendition of “Bugler’s Holiday” were also wonderful. The entire show was FAST paced and the long farewells and slide shows of the past were excised from the program.

Congratulations to Kristina Smaby, Miss Wisconsin 2009. Kristina is a wonderful young lady and you can see me with her at last year’s Miss Wisconsin afterparty.

I judged Kristina last year when we sent her to Miss Wisconsin for the third time as Miss Prairie Shores 2008. She is an incredible dancer and a great interviewer (Kristina–call us!) and we know she will be a great competitor this year in Las Vegas for the Miss America four pointed tiara.

Congratulations, Kristina and have a great year!
